The hotel is very close to the airport. If you take the AirPort Express train to the Asia World Expo station, it’s maybe 3-5 minutes away by feet - it’s actually directly connected to the station so you don’t even have to go outside! They provide a shuttle to the airport every 15 minutes which is great. I think the ride lasts maybe 5 minutes? It’s very short, the airport is genuinely super close.
The staff is very helpful. According to Hong Kong law, the hotels cannot distribute plastic water bottles so instead, each room gets a glass bottle that you can go refill whenever. There are several stations on each floor to do this. I thought this was a really good system.
They have a bar with a very nice atmosphere. Many people are sitting there waiting for their late flights and the vibe was really good!
It’s somewhat of a basic business hotel. It was nice and clean but I felt like it was nothing extra - for this reason, I thought the price was way too high. This was my only problem. However, we also need to remember that this is Hong Kong, so it won’t be cheap.

Great location for over night stays if in transit through Hong Kong. Free shuttle service to and from airport and also to and from local shopping precinct (which also is home to the cable car which takes you up to the great Buddha statue). Highly recommend for short transit stays, otherwise a bit far out from main city / destinations. Rooms clean & comfortable
